Commercial site clearing services involve the removal of vegetation, debris, and other obstructions from large parcels of land to prepare them for development or use. These services typically include the removal of trees, shrubs, stumps, and underbrush, as well as the grading and leveling of the terrain to create a suitable foundation for construction projects.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and loaders are often employed to efficiently clear extensive areas, ensuring the site is ready for subsequent development activities.
This service addresses several common problems faced during land development. Overgrown vegetation, fallen trees, and accumulated debris can hinder construction progress, increase safety risks, and lead to delays. Additionally, unmanaged land can pose challenges for drainage, erosion control, and compliance with local regulations. Commercial site clearing helps mitigate these issues by creating a clean, level, and accessible space that facilitates construction, landscaping, or other commercial uses.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Site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Auburn,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Per Acre Costs - Commercial site clearing typically ranges from $1,200 to $3,500 per acre, depending on vegetation density and site conditions. For example, clearing a half-acre lot might cost around $600 to $1,750. Costs can vary based on the size and complexity of the project.
Per Square Foot Pricing - Some service providers charge between $0.50 and $2.00 per square foot for clearing services. For instance, clearing a 10,000-square-foot site could cost approximately $5,000 to $20,000. Larger or more challenging sites tend to increase the overall expense.
Heavy Equipment Fees - Use of machinery such as bulldozers or excavators can add $500 to $2,000 per day to the project cost. The total expense depends on the duration of equipment use and site accessibility, influencing overall costs significantly.
Additional Services - Extra tasks like debris removal or stump grinding may cost an additional $500 to $3,000. These services are often billed separately and can vary based on the scope of work required after initial clearing.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
